About BinSentry: BinSentry is an extremely fast-growing ag-tech company started here in KW. BinSentry is focused on providing solutions for the agriculture supply chain that help increase efficiency, reduce costs, and enhance profitability. As a leader in the use of artificial intelligence, BinSentry offers technology solutions that pair best-in-class optical sensors with user-friendly software to provide our customers with enhanced forecasting and decision-making capabilities. With our technology, feed mills and protein producers are enhancing feed ordering efficiency, raising healthier animals, improving employee safety, reducing their environmental footprint and - most significantly - uncovering new savings. Today, BinSentry is monitoring more than 64,000 bins in real time across North America. When it comes to the future of agricultural supply chain management, BinSentry is leading the way. As we scale up, we're looking for a Senior Embedded Software Developer to help us build the embedded software that is changing the face of the feed industry. Job Summary: The ideal candidate will design, develop, and maintain software for embedded systems, working closely with BinSentry’s hardware and software teams to ensure seamless integration. You will write embedded C for the microcontrollers which drive our feed bin sensors using FreeRTOS. You will drive our embedded Linux project using Yocto and write Python code, which supports our HD line. You will be responsible for writing power-efficient and reliable/resilient code, conducting system debugging, reliability testing, optimizing performance and managing fleet deployments. You will work across our entire product line, including writing software for brand new hardware projects.
